Our client, a private household with multiple residences, is seeking a Director of Residence to oversee daily operations and ensure seamless support across three properties. In this highly trusted role, you will manage household staff, coordinate maintenance and vendor relationships, and assist with complex personal and property‑related logistics. The ideal candidate brings 10+ years of experience supporting UHNW families or luxury residential environments and thrives in roles requiring discretion, organization, and high‑touch service.
Responsibilities- Oversee daily operations and standards across three residences
- Manage housekeeping teams and outsourced vendors
- Coordinate home maintenance, repairs, and occasional renovation efforts
- Maintain household inventories, manuals, and property checklists
- Prepare homes for arrival and ensure they remain organized, stocked, and guest‑ready
- Arrange travel and assist with personal tasks
- Manage calendars, appointments, and logistics for the principals
- Support events and gatherings including catering, rentals, and onsite execution
- Oversee storage systems and conduct audit/rotation of household items
- Coordinate vehicle maintenance
- Liaise with contractors, staff, and the family office to ensure smooth communication and continuity
- 10+ years of experience supporting private households or luxury estates
- Proven success managing staff and multi‑property operations
- Strong organizational, multitasking, and leadership skills
- Exceptional communication and judgment with absolute discretion
- Ability to travel and adapt to shifting needs while remaining highly proactive
- Excellent attention to detail and proficiency with household/task management technology
- A polished, positive, service‑oriented demeanor with the ability to maintain professional boundaries
Enjoy a competitive salary plus an annual bonus, with a benefits stipend and generous paid time off.
